Hello, I have started to make a binding to POSIX 1003.5 under Windows-NT in Ada95 with GNAT. The binding is build on top of the Win32Ada binding from Intermetrics. If I remember somebody have asked (some time ago) if such a binding existed and if not was thinking to do it. Please contact me as we could join our effort into this binding. Some functionality are really hard to implement like POSIX_Process_Primitives.Start_Process[_Search] POSIX_Process_Primitives.Wait_For_Child_Process Some functionality are without counterpart under NT : POSIX_Signals If you have idea that could help, please feel free to send me a mail. What is done : POSIX (not tested) POSIX_Files (some part tested) POSIX_IO (not tested) POSIX_File_Status (some part tested) POSIX_Calendar (not tested) POSIX_Process_Identification (some part tested) The error code is not implemented for the moment. The binding sources will be freely available. Pascal. PS : I'll be out of my office until Monday Jully 15. --|------------------------------------------------------------ --| Pascal Obry Team-Ada Member | --| | --| EDF-DER-IPN-SID- Ing�nierie des Syst�mes d'Informations | --| | --| Bureau G1-010 e-mail: pascal.obry@der.edfgdf.fr | --| 1 Av G�n�ral de Gaulle voice : +33-1-47.65.50.91 | --| 92141 Clamart CEDEX fax : +33-1-47.65.50.07 | --| FRANCE | --|------------------------------------------------------------ --| --| http://ourworld.compuserve.com/homepages/pascal_obry --| --| "The best way to travel is by means of imagination"